My students are used to having the support of multiple instructors in my classroom. During distance learning we have been providing paper packets as well as making phone calls and sending letters through traditional mail weekly. However my students also have access to Google Classroom, Google Meet and our online academic curriculum Unique Learning System. All three of these programs have apps that can be installed on the kindle. Unfortunately my class does not Qualify for funding through the CARES Act because my classroom is in a building ran by the local (County) Intermediate School District. My students could not use the laptops that act may provide even if those funds were an option. They need an easy touch interface to be successful in both our online interactive curriculum and to see teachers on Google Meet! I wish for all kids to be able to have user friendly technology to help them feel connected to school staff and each other. Distance learning has been so isolating for my high risk students. Their progress with communication and social skills are also negatively impacted by this social isolation. I was able to make a video call on the phone of a parent this semester where a non verbal student smiled and laughed and even signed to me! He was so happy! I cannot express how important and vital it is that these students maintain those social connections to their school team!
